Hair analysis is now regarded as an effective method for identifying drug and alcohol consumption. Hair retains a prolonged record of exposure to alcohol and other substances by embedding biomarkers within the strands as they grow. When taken close to the scalp, hair can reveal drug and alcohol use for approximately three months. The collection of hair samples is straightforward, relatively resistant to tampering, and easy to transport.
A sample of 1.5 inches comprising around 200 hair strands (approximately the thickness of a #2 pencil) near the scalp constitutes 100mg, which is optimal for testing and verification. For EtG extensions and/or tests exceeding 10 panels, 150mg is preferred. We suggest using a jeweler’s scale for measurement. Should scalp hair be inaccessible, an equivalent quantity of body hair can be gathered. When we mention head hair, we refer exclusively to scalp hair. Body hair encompasses all other types (facial, axillary, etc.).
Process Overview
There are four fundamental phases in the lab analysis of a drug test: Accessioning, Screening, Extraction, and Confirmation.
Accessioning involves the primary handling of a sample into the lab’s database. This step includes checking that the sample was correctly sealed and dispatched, assigning a unique LAN (Laboratory Accessioning Number), and filling in any missing data not supplied by an electronic chain of custody application.
Screening acts as an initial assessment for substance abuse. Though it’s an economical method to eliminate drug use in most cases, a positive Screening necessitates validation to be legally viable. Samples that are tentatively positive in Screening require further confirmation.
Should a specimen be tentatively positive at the Screening phase, more hair is extracted from the preliminary sample for Extraction. At this stage, drugs are isolated from hair at significantly lower concentrations than with other methods (e.g., urine or oral fluid), explaining why hair drug tests are the most challenging to execute.
Any positive outcome from Screening undergoes Confirmation through GC/MS, GC/MS/MS, or LC/MS/MS techniques. Samples with presumptive positivity are cleaned before confirmation as required. The whole lab sequence from Accessioning to Confirmation is evaluated under both the CAP (College of American Pathologists) Hair designation and ISO / IEC 17025 accreditation standards.

Note: While often named "hair follicle tests", the examination targets the hair strand, not the follicle beneath the scalp
